On his 40th birthday, Rafael Nadal still looms large at Roland Garros
Rafael Nadal celebrates his 40th birthday on June 3, marking a significant milestone in his life and career. Known as the 'King of Clay,' Nadal has transitioned into retirement but continues to influence the French Open. His legacy remains strong, with players and fans alike still feeling his presence at the tournament.
